Bandar seri begawan: His Majesty Sultan Haji Hassanal Bolkiah Mu’izzaddin Waddaulah, Sultan and Yang Di-Pertuan of Brunei Darussalam, received His Excellency Bendito dos Santos Freitas, Minister of Foreign Affairs and Cooperation of the Democratic Republic of Timor-Leste, in an audience ceremony at Istana Nurul Iman.

According to Radio Television Brunei, the meeting took place during His Excellency’s two-day visit to Brunei. The visit aims to express gratitude for Brunei’s consistent support for Timor-Leste’s accession to ASEAN. Timor-Leste is anticipated to officially become the 11th member of ASEAN during the 47th ASEAN Summit set for 26th October 2025 in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.

Present during the audience were Yang Berhormat Dato Seri Setia Awang Haji Erywan bin Pehin Datu Pekerma Jaya Haji Mohammad Yusof, the Second Minister of Foreign Affairs, and Dato Seri Paduka Awang Mohd Riza bin Dato Paduka Haji Mohd Yunos, Deputy Minister at the Prime Minister’s Office. His Excellency Bendito dos Santos Freitas was accompanied by His Excellency Abel Guterres, Ambassador Extraordinary of the Democratic Republic of Timor-Leste to Brunei Darussalam, and Mr. Vanio Florival Ximenes de Jesus, National Director for South East Asia,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Cooperation.
